About Candy
Meet Candy, the epitome of feline charm and grace, ready to grace her forever home with her presence. At nine years young, this indoor-only lady boasts a stunning blue-grey coat and captivating green eyes that are sure to enchant. Candy, a precious soul rescued from a research facility, is litter-trained and exudes an air of serene beauty, making her the perfect addition to a loving home.
Upon first meeting, Candy may come across as shy, yet she quickly warms up, revealing her affectionate and confident personality. Her favorite pastimes include lounging on the couch and people-watching from the balcony, where she contemplates her kingdom with gentle wisdom. While she adores receiving a forehead smooch or a gentle scalp massage, she cherishes her independence, preferring affection on her terms – a trait that speaks of her unique personality.
Candy's behaviour speaks a language of its own, reflecting her adorable quirks. Settle in for a meal, and she'll join you, symbolising her social nature, but she will never steal you food. Her little meows vary in meaning – a request for affection or a polite decline, depending on the moment. And when she shows her belly, it's her way of saying she's had enough pampering for now. This beautiful feline communicates her needs with elegance and charm, ensuring a harmonious coexistence with her human companions.
Medical notes reveal Candy's triumph over anxiety and dental issues, testament to her resilience. With just half a tablet a day and some Feliway, she maintains her cheerful demeanour. Now in excellent health, Candy is all set to enrich her new home with love, beauty, and a dash of feline mystique. She is ideally suited to a household without young children, where her subtle cues and preferences can be appreciated and respected.

Adoption details
1. Fill Out Our Form
Enter as much information as possible so we can match the right animal to your needs and expectations, choose a form below that relates to either cat or dog.
2. Email & Phone Interview
A Beagle Freedom representative will assess and reply to your application via email, a phone interview and meeting will be arranged if all goes well.
3. House Check & Introductions
We bring the beagle to your home to meet your family and pets and to check the suitability of the fencing.
4. Trial Period & Final Adoption
If all goes well, we leave the beagle with you on a trial period. If the trial goes well and everyone is happy – in particular, the animals, then we process the paperwork and transfer ownership to you.
